Synopsis

Gain confidence and enjoy breastfeeding. Get physically and mentally ready to breastfeed your baby. This easy-to-follow guide, written by two maternal/child health experts, provides practical, reassuring advice on everything from making preparations at home and starting to breastfeed at the hospital to breastfeeding while working and weaning. This title features: the dummies way explanations in plain English; 'get in, get out' information; icons and other navigational aids; tear-out cheat sheet; top ten lists; and, a dash of humor and fun. This title helps to discover how to: tell if your baby is getting enough milk; care for your breasts and nipples; solve breastfeeding problems; nurse two children at a time; and, breastfeed outside the home.

Author Bio
Sharon Perkins, RN, coauthor of Fertility For Dummies, has more than two decades of experience in maternal/child health. Carol Vannais, RN, educates parents-to-be in the benefits of breastfeeding.
